29 /*
30  * DOS filesystem for libsa
31  * standalone - uses no device, works only with DOS running
32  * needs lowlevel parts from dos_file.S
33  */
34 
35 #include <lib/libsa/stand.h>
36 
37 #include "diskbuf.h"
38 #include "dosfile.h"
39 
40 struct dosfile {
41 	int doshandle, off;
42 };
43 
44 extern int doserrno;	/* in dos_file.S */
45 
46 static int dos2errno(void);
47 
48 static int
dos2errno(void)49 dos2errno(void)
50 {
51 	int err;
52 
53 	switch (doserrno) {
54 	    case 1: /* invalid function number */
55 	    case 4: /* too many open files */
56 	    case 12: /* invalid access mode */
57 	    default:
58 		err = EIO;
59 		break;
60 	    case 2: /* file not found */
61 	    case 3: /* path not found */
62 		err = ENOENT;
63 		break;
64 	    case 5: /* access denied */
65 		err = EPERM;
66 		break;
67 	    case 6: /* invalid handle */
68 		err = EINVAL;
69 		break;
70 	}
71 	return err;
72 }

74 __compactcall int
dos_open(const char * path,struct open_file * f)75 dos_open(const char *path, struct open_file *f)
76 {
77 	struct dosfile *df;
78 
79 	df = (struct dosfile *) alloc(sizeof(*df));
80 	if (!df)
81 		return -1;
82 
83 	df->off = 0;
84 	df->doshandle = dosopen(path);
85 	if (df->doshandle < 0) {
86 #ifdef DEBUG
87 		printf("DOS error %d\n", doserrno);
88 #endif
89 		dealloc(df, sizeof(*df));
90 		return dos2errno();
91 	}
92 	f->f_fsdata = (void *) df;
93 	return 0;
94 }
95 
96 __compactcall int
dos_read(struct open_file * f,void * addr,size_t size,size_t * resid)97 dos_read(struct open_file *f, void *addr, size_t size, size_t *resid)
98 {
99 	struct dosfile *df;
100 	int             got;
101 	static int      tc = 0;
102 
103 	df = (struct dosfile *) f->f_fsdata;
104 
105 	if (!(tc++ % 4))
106 		twiddle();
107 
108 	if ((unsigned long) addr >= 0x10000) {
109 		u_int           lsize = size;
110 
111 		while (lsize > 0) {
112 			u_int           tsize;
113 			size_t          tgot;
114 			char		*p = addr;
115 
116 			tsize = lsize;
117 
118 			if (tsize > DISKBUFSIZE)
119 				tsize = DISKBUFSIZE;
120 
121 			alloc_diskbuf(dos_read);
122 
123 			tgot = dosread(df->doshandle, diskbufp, tsize);
124 			if (tgot < 0) {
125 #ifdef DEBUG
126 				printf("DOS error %d\n", doserrno);
127 #endif
128 				return dos2errno();
129 			}
130 			memcpy(p, diskbufp, tgot);
131 
132 			p += tgot;
133 			lsize -= tgot;
134 
135 			if (tgot != tsize)
136 				break;	/* EOF */
137 		}
138 		got = size - lsize;
139 	} else {
140 		got = dosread(df->doshandle, addr, size);
141 
142 		if (got < 0) {
143 #ifdef DEBUG
144 			printf("DOS error %d\n", doserrno);
145 #endif
146 			return dos2errno();
147 		}
148 	}
149 
150 	df->off += got;
151 	size -= got;
152 
153 	if (resid)
154 		*resid = size;
155 	return 0;
156 }
157 
158 __compactcall int
dos_close(struct open_file * f)159 dos_close(struct open_file *f)
160 {
161 	struct dosfile *df;
162 	df = (struct dosfile *) f->f_fsdata;
163 
164 	dosclose(df->doshandle);
165 
166 	if (df)
167 		dealloc(df, sizeof(*df));
168 	return 0;
169 }
170 
171 __compactcall int
dos_write(struct open_file * f,void * start,size_t size,size_t * resid)172 dos_write(struct open_file *f, void *start, size_t size, size_t *resid)
173 {
174 	return EROFS;
175 }
176 
177 __compactcall int
dos_stat(struct open_file * f,struct stat * sb)178 dos_stat(struct open_file *f, struct stat *sb)
179 {
180 	sb->st_mode = 0444;
181 	sb->st_nlink = 1;
182 	sb->st_uid = 0;
183 	sb->st_gid = 0;
184 	sb->st_size = -1;
185 	return 0;
186 }
187 
188 __compactcall off_t
dos_seek(struct open_file * f,off_t offset,int where)189 dos_seek(struct open_file *f, off_t offset, int where)
190 {
191 	struct dosfile *df;
192 	int             doswhence, res;
193 #ifdef DOS_CHECK
194 	int             checkoffs;
195 #endif
196 	df = (struct dosfile *) f->f_fsdata;
197 
198 	switch (where) {
199 	case SEEK_SET:
200 		doswhence = 0;
201 #ifdef DOS_CHECK
202 		checkoffs = offset;	/* don't trust DOS */
203 #endif
204 		break;
205 	case SEEK_CUR:
206 		doswhence = 1;
207 #ifdef DOS_CHECK
208 		checkoffs = df->off + offset;
209 #endif
210 		break;
211 	case SEEK_END:
212 		doswhence = 2;
213 #ifdef DOS_CHECK
214 		checkoffs = -1;	/* we dont know len */
215 #endif
216 		break;
217 	default:
218 		errno = EOFFSET;
219 		return -1;
220 	}
221 	res = dosseek(df->doshandle, offset, doswhence);
222 	if (res == -1) {
223 		errno = dos2errno();
224 		return -1;
225 	}
226 #ifdef DOS_CHECK
227 	if ((checkoffs != -1) && (res != checkoffs)) {
228 		printf("dosfile: unexpected seek result (%d+%d(%d)=%d)\n",
229 		       df->off, offset, where, res);
230 		errno = EOFFSET;
231 		return -1;
232 	}
233 #endif
234 	df->off = res;
235 	return res;
236 }
